Disc Brake Assembly Line

Built for Safety. Engineered for Speed. Designed to Perform.

Motionworks Robotics’ Disc Brake Assembly Line delivers a fully automated solution for assembling disc brake modules — including calipers, brackets, pistons, seals, pads, and associated hardware. Designed for high-volume, high-precision production, this line ensures complete safety compliance, zero-defect manufacturing, and repeatable performance — every time.

Tailored for Tier-1 suppliers and automotive OEMs, the system is modular, scalable, and fully compatible with Industry 4.0 environments. From raw component handling to final torqueing and leak testing, every process is automated and traceable.

Key Features

Modular & Scalable Architecture

Custom-configurable stations that allow easy scaling for different brake types, model variants, or output capacity.

Precision Torque-Controlled Assembly

Critical fastening points — such as slider bolts, bleed screws, and guide pins — are assembled with programmable torque accuracy and angle monitoring.

Seal & Boot Insertion with Verification

Automated insertion of rubber seals and dust boots with vision validation to ensure proper placement and fit.
